  • Override primary visibility on a specific render element?

    I know this is probably asking too much, but is there any method that would allow me to override primary visibility on just a specific render element, specifically an ExtraTex?

  • #2
    You can exclude objects from the ExtraTex, wouldn't that work for this case? The excluded object will appear black in the extraTex, though, but it is how it works. Other than that, we don't have a way of making one object invisible to a render element, without the object removing the color from that render element.
